Explicit Reproducing Kernel Particle Methods for large deformation problems

International Journal for Numerical Methods in Engineering, 1998
Summary: The explicit reproducing kernel particle method (RKPM) is presented and applied to the simulations of large deformation problems. RKPM is a meshless method which does not need a mesh structure in its formulation. Because of this mesh-free property, RKPM is able to simulate large deformation problems without remeshing which is often required ...

A reproducing kernel method with nodal interpolation property

International Journal for Numerical Methods in Engineering, 2003
AbstractA general formulation for developing reproducing kernel (RK) interpolation is presented. This is based on the coupling of a primitive function and an enrichment function. The primitive function introduces discrete Kronecker delta properties, while the enrichment function constitutes reproducing conditions.
